Glen Ellyn won't allow Jehovah's Witnesses brochure rack on sidewalk
http://www.chicagotribune.com/suburbs/glen-ellyn/ct-jehovah-witness-brochures-tl-20141209-story.html
The Glen Ellyn Village Board (USA) on Monday night voted 4-2 to reject a request by a Kingdom Hall of Jehovah's Witnesses north of Glen Ellyn to place a portable brochure rack on a public sidewalk in downtown Glen Ellyn for evangelistic purposes.
Glen Ellyn currently bars commercial signage and the placement of any kind of structure — whether temporary or permanent — on its public sidewalks without Village Board approval. At the same time, free speech laws make street ministry or evangelization legal.
Recently, the Kingdom Hall of Jehovah's Witnesses had been using the Glen Ellyn Metra station property to perform street ministry that included its portable brochure rack. The railroad subsequently revoked that permission, said Village Attorney Greg Mathews, prompting the Witnesses to approach the village.
So, the Witnesses instead proposed setting up their rack in front of The Patio Restaurant, 552 Crescent Blvd., and just south of the Illinois Prairie Path and north of Olive and Vinnie's at 449 N. Main St. The Kingdom Hall made its request, which was for two days a month for an initial term of three months, to trustees.
On Monday, several trustees said they felt a public sidewalk is the wrong place for an evangelistic cart. Trustee Tim O'Shea likened the Jehovah's Witnesses brochure rack to a sign, while Trustee Jim Burket said he simply is not a fan of the placement of items on the public sidewalk.
Trustee Pete Ladesic told his colleagues he has no issue with the hall's evangelistic efforts, but that he did not support the use of the brochure rack, suggesting that approving the hall's request would be "starting to go down (the) path" of setting a precedent. He suggested that the hall's leaders should instead search for a stretch of privately owned sidewalk in downtown Glen Ellyn for the rack, which then would be out of the village's purview.
Trustee Tim Elliott, who supported the measure, said that the hall's request provided a low-risk opportunity to evaluate the proposed use of a brochure rack.
"This is a religious organization that is doing this on a nonprofit basis and it's (for) two days a month for a period of three months," Elliott said. "My recommendation would be that I think we ought to let them go with it. If staff says this creates a firestorm of protests and issues and traffic, then we've learned our lesson, and if this applicant or others come to us in the future, we can say no."
No officials from the Kingdom Hall attended Monday night's meeting.

Village Board of Glen Ellyn (USA)
Consider a license agreement with Kingdom Hall of Jehovah's Witnesses to allow a brochure rack on the public sidewalk in downtown Glen Ellyn. (Planning and Development)
Don Jurasz, Minister of the Kingdom Hall of Jehovah's Witnesses located at 24W410 Great Western Avenue in unincorporated Glen Ellyn, has requested permission to place a brochure rack on the public sidewalk in conjunction with a public outreach ministry activity. Members of the congregation wish to conduct street ministry and speak to members of the public on public property as an effort of the church. There are no restrictions on individuals performing street ministry, evangelization, or witnessing. These activities are protected as free speech and individuals may engage in these activities at any time. However, the church wishes to place a brochure rack on the public sidewalk during their outreach ministry efforts (see attached photo).
The placement of a structure on the public sidewalk is prohibited by the Village Code and therefore requires either a Village Board waiver or approval of a license agreement by the Village Board.
Village Board code waivers are generally intended for infrequent or one-time events. Since the church wishes to undertake these efforts over a few months, the issuance of a license agreement is a more appropriate mechanism to grant approval of the request. The church initially requested permission to conduct their activities once or twice a day on three days each week for a period of 6 months. In conversations with Village staff, the request has been scaled back to twice a month for 3 months. The church can certainly perform their ministry, without the placement of the brochure rack, as often as they wish.
The church also initially requested to perform their ministry at the southwest corner of the intersection of Park and Crescent Boulevards. The Police Department expressed a safety concern regarding the location due to the existence of many conflicting distractions at that intersection (e.g.; student crossings, commuter crossings, vehicle movements and the train tracks). Staff suggested two safer locations in the downtown that contained sufficient sidewalk width and offered less distractions to motorists and pedestrians. Those locations are in front of The Patio Restaurant at 552 Crescent Boulevard and just south of the Prairie Path and north of Olive and Vinnie’s at 449 N. Main Street. The attached map shows the proposed locations.
As requested by the church, staff has prepared a draft license agreement for Village Board consideration. The draft license agreement, attached, requires submittal of the standard Certificate of Liability Insurance in advance of the placement of the brochure rack. It also requires the typical 5-foot wide clear path and a minimum of one person accompanying the rack at all times. The church can locate the brochure rack in either one location or the other during their ministry operations. They may place the brochure rack any two days per month between 6:30 a.m. and 11:00 a.m. or between 3:30 p.m. and 7:00 p.m. The agreement expires March 31, 2015. If the church wished to continue the use of the brochure rack beyond that timeframe, they would need to reappear before the Village Board for a new license agreement.
Request: That the Village Board consider the request of the Kingdom Hall of Jehovah’s Witnesses for a license agreement to allow a brochure rack on the public sidewalk in downtown Glen Ellyn.

BRITAIN - A high court judge has ruled that the son of two Jehovah’s Witnesses can be given a blood transfusion despite religious objections from his parents.
Mr Justice Moylan was told by doctors that the “very young” boy had suffered severe burns in an accident and might need a blood transfusion. The judge concluded that a blood transfusion would be in the youngster’s best interests in spite of the “deeply held views” of his mother and father.
The judge said a health trust with responsibility for treating the boy had asked for a ruling. He did not name anyone involved and did not give the child’s age.

Child Shunned by Jehovah’s Witnesses Convention at Etihad Stadium
Melbourne, Australia
While over 70,000 people attend the Jehovah’s Witnesses International Convention at Etihad Stadium this weekend, 17-19 October, one child will not be attending.
A special needs child has been prevented from attending the religious event by the refusal of the Jehovah’s Witnesses and their administrative corporation, Watchtower Bible and Tract Society of Australia, to accommodate any potential emergency health needs of the child.
Allegations have been made that the child has been discriminated against on the basis of her emergency medical needs. Despite efforts by Melbourne Stadiums Limited (MSL) the operators of Etihad Stadium, the Jehovah’s Witness event organisers refused to help the child attend.
The father plans to lodge a discrimination complaint with the Human Rights Commissioner on behalf of his daughter against the organisers of the Jehovah’s Witnesses International Convention at Etihad Stadium. “If I can’t find a lawyer to represent my little girl in this complaint then I will lodge it myself,” the father said, adding, “children should not be discriminated against because of their disabilities or medical needs.”
In a letter issued this week to the managers of Etihad Stadium, MSL, the father of the six-year-old child thanked the stadium administrators for their help over the past six months in trying to assist in attending the event. In his letter the father stated:
“Part of the medical management plan for our daughter is for us to register her condition with the first aid department at any large event we attend. This includes giving the first aid officers a copy of our details, our daughter’s medical condition and history, and the medical emergency management system in place in the event she does suddenly collapse and needs emergency treatment.”
The child and her family’s attendance at the event hit a hurdle when the Jehovah’s Witnesses and Watchtower Society informed the father that they do not provide any health services in the State of Victoria and therefore cannot accept any health information.
